To detect stanozolol from this metabolite, a complex combination of methods involving electrospray ionization (ESI) and liquid chromatography mass spectrometry (LC-MS) was more recently developed. Simply put, these techniques create ions which can be separated and identified by their mass to characterize and identify the metabolites present. Anabolic drugs or steroids (synthetic derivatives of testosterone) – Anabolic steroids are synthetic forms of the male sex hormone, testosterone. The main function of this hormone is to synthesize a protein that builds additional muscle size and increase strength. These steroids are generally consumed in dosages that exceed the body’s natural production. Blood doping – this involves removing blood and then re-transfusing it a few weeks later after the lost red blood cells have been replaced.

Diuretics may also dilute the urine, which can reduce the concentration of the PED below the limit of detection. Blood boosters (erythropoietins, other erythropoiesis-stimulating agents ESAs, and transfusions) increase endurance in events such as cycling, long-distance running, and skiing. Athletes also may combine AASs and erythropoietins to train harder and recover faster.

Despite these efforts, the use of PEDs remains a significant problem in sports today. According to a 2019 report by the World Anti-Doping Agency (WADA), there were over 1,500 confirmed cases of doping violations across various sports4. This number likely represents only a fraction of the actual prevalence of PED use, as many athletes are able to evade detection through sophisticated doping regimens and masking agents. The conceptual and technological framework of gene therapy in humans has largely been developed in hereditary diseases and Drug rehabilitation some types of cancer (409, 410). The methods used to deliver genetic material include the naked DNA, viral vectors, and genetically modified stem cells. Viral vectors are the most frequently used approach for delivery of genetic material (385, 404–407).

Blood doping agents increase the oxygen-carrying capacity of blood beyond the individual’s natural capacity.39 They are used in endurance sports like long-distance running, cycling, and Nordic skiing. Recombinant human erythropoietin (rhEPO) is one of the most widely known drugs in this class.2839 The Athlete Biological Passport is the only indirect testing method for detection of blood doping. ESA use is most prevalent in endurance sports, such as distance running, cycling, race-walking, cross-country skiing, biathlons, and triathlons (387).
